The ingredients needed to prepare Pav bhaji:
- You need 2 of potatoes.
- Prepare 3 of tomatoes.
- Use 1 cup of cauliflower.
- Prepare 1 of capsicum.
- Use 2 of onions.
- Provide 3 of green chillies.
- Get 2 spoons of Ginger garlic paste.
- Provide 1 teaspoon of pav bhaji masala.
- Prepare as per taste of Red chilli powder.
- You need as required of Coriander powder.
- Get 1 pinch of sugar.
- Provide 1 of Lemon juice.
- Provide to taste of Salt.
Steps to make Pav bhaji:
- Boil the potatoes and cauliflower till soft. Mash them in a bowl..
- Finely chop capsicum,tomatoes,onions,chillies..
- Heat oil in a kadhai. Put jeera and green chillies. Add ginger garlic paste..
- Add chopped onion and capsicum till it becomes soft.Then add tomatoes and cook for 10 min on low flame..
- Add red chilli powder,salt, coriander powder,sugar,pav bhaji masala with mashed potatoes and cauliflower. Mash it well..
- Add 2 cups of water. Cover with lid and cook for 15-20 mins on low flame..
- Add lemon juice and garnish with fresh coriander. Serve hot with butter and pav..
Pav Bhaji is a favorite fast food dish in India. Pav is buns and bhaji is the mixed spicy vegetables. This is a very popular dish with roadside vendors.
